- Different selection conditions at DD and DB level ?The SAP error message MC414, which states "Different selection conditions at DD and DB level," typically occurs in the context of data extraction or reporting in SAP, particularly when there is a mismatch between the selection criteria defined in the Data Dictionary (DD) and the actual data in the database (DB).
Cause:
The error can arise due to several reasons, including:
Inconsistent Selection Criteria: The selection conditions defined in the Data Dictionary (like InfoObjects in SAP BW) do not match the actual data selection criteria being applied at the database level. This can happen if there are changes in the data model or if the data has been modified without updating the corresponding selection criteria.
Data Inconsistency: There may be inconsistencies in the data itself, such as missing or incorrect entries that do not meet the defined selection criteria.
Transport Issues: If there have been recent transports of changes to the Data Dictionary or related objects, it is possible that the changes have not been fully synchronized with the database.
Authorization Issues: Sometimes, the user executing the report may not have the necessary authorizations to access certain data, leading to discrepancies in the selection conditions.
Solution:
To resolve the MC414 error, you can take the following steps:
Check Selection Criteria: Review the selection criteria defined in the Data Dictionary and ensure they match the expected conditions in the database. This may involve checking the InfoObjects, InfoProviders, or any other relevant data structures.
Data Consistency Check: Perform a consistency check on the data to ensure that all entries meet the defined selection criteria. You can use transaction codes like RSA1 (for BW) to check the data model and consistency.
Rebuild or Refresh Data: If there are inconsistencies, consider rebuilding or refreshing the data in the InfoProvider or the relevant data structure. This may involve reloading data from the source system.
Check Authorizations: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to access the data. You can check the user roles and authorizations in transaction SU01.
Transport Management: If the issue arose after a transport, verify that all related objects were transported correctly and that there are no missing dependencies.
Debugging: If the issue persists, consider debugging the report or program that is generating the error to identify the specific selection conditions being applied.
